Solution for 2(108-10x)=7x-27 equation:



2(108-10x)=7x-27
We move all terms to the left:
2(108-10x)-(7x-27)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
2(-10x+108)-(7x-27)=0
We multiply parentheses
-20x-(7x-27)+216=0
We get rid of parentheses
-20x-7x+27+216=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-27x+243=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
-27x=-243
x=-243/-27
x=+9
